December affirms the year-end with a sustained high temperature, making
Mariscal Estigarribia apt for those seeking a hot holiday season. Coupled with this, it experiences the highest amount of rainfall for the year amounting to 119mm (4.69"). It retains the status-quo established in
November, with high temperature and substantial rainfall. Compared to the preceding month of November, December records an almost parallel weather pattern, concluding the year with a warm and moist climate.
Temperature
With the advent of December, Mariscal Estigarribia's high-temperatures adjust to a sweltering 35.1°C (95.2°F), closely aligning with the preceding month. Mariscal Estigarribia, after hot December days, encounters a marked drop to an average nighttime temperature of 22.1°C (71.8°F).
Heat index
In December, the average heat index is computed to be a burning hot 46°C (114.8°F).
Watchful: Heat cramps and heat exhaustion are predicted. Continued exertion could lead to heatstroke.
When assessing, remember that heat index measurements are for light winds and shaded spots. Direct sunlight might cause an increase of up to 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ees in the heat index.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'apparent temperature' or 'real feel', comes about by integrating the temperature readings with the humidity levels. The evaporation of sweat is a natural cooling mechanism of the human body, facilitated by perspiration. Increased relative humidity interferes with body cooling by slowing the rate of evaporation, resulting in a slower body cooling rate and a heightened feeling of heat. Increasing body temperatures can be a precursor to dehydration if the body can't shed the extra heat.
Humidity
In Mariscal Estigarribia, the average relative humidity in December is 62%.
Rainfall
In December, the rain falls for 8 days. Throughout December, 119mm (4.69") of precipitation is accumulated. Throughout the year, there are 71 rainfall days, and 777mm (30.59") of precipitation is accumulated.
Daylight
December has the longest days of the year, with an average of 13h and 30min of daylight.
On the first day of December in Mariscal Estigarribia, sunrise is at 06:10 and sunset at 19:33.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 06:22 and sunset at 19:49 -03.
